
微观开场:一笔授权,可以决定你数字资产的命运。本手册式分析将逐项拆解TP钱包(通用热钱包)中最常见的“不安全授权”场景,并给出可执行流程与工程级防护建议。
一、常见不安全授权与危害
- 无限额度授权(approve无限/永不过期):合约一旦被滥用,可清空资产。
- setApprovalForAll与代理合约:批量转移权限,链上难以即时追溯。

- 签名任意交易/消息:授权后可替换为恶意合约执行任意调用。
- 助记词/私钥导入与持久托管:单点泄露风险极高。
二、实时数据保护(工程要点)
- 本地密钥隔离:采用Secure Enclave/KeyStore与生物绑定。
- 交易解析层:对DApp请求进行ABI逆向、白名单字段解析并在UI明确展示“可转移金额/允许调用函数/到期时间”。
- Mempool感知与阻断:在本地或托管服务中对高风险交易(大额、非白名单合约)做延时或二次确认。
- 撤销/最小化策略:默认设置为最小额度与时间窗,提供一键撤销入口(调用revoke接口并提示gas估算)。
三、挖矿与资源滥用风险
- 恶意DApp利用签名要求注入挖矿脚本或替换gas策略,导致小钱包被用作Gas抽取点。
- 防护思路:禁止DApp直接修改gas参数,提示并锁定非安全gas取值;对大规模签名行为触发风控。
四、智能化资产增值与风险边界
- 自动化理财/质押功能需引入多重策略:策略沙箱、模拟收益回测、合约审计状态标签与期限锁定。
- 风险案例:授权后自动质押到未经审计的收益池,导致锁仓或被rug-pull。
五、创新数据管理与流程(详细步骤)
1) 请求接收:解析DApp请求,生成“权限摘要”。
2) 风险评估:本地策略引擎结合链上历史(合约交互次数、异常行为)打分。
3) 用户呈现:将权限摘要翻译为易懂动作(可转多少、可做https://www.yingyangjiankangxuexiao.com ,什么、有效期)。
4) 最小化执行:默认生成仅需额度与短期有效的交易;如需更高权限,提示多因素确认。
5) 监控与回滚:上链后同步监控异常调用,发现异常自动发出撤销提醒并推荐一键revoke流程。
六、智能化数字路径(实现要点)
- 引入MPC或智能合约钱包(AA)以减少私钥暴露。
- 采用可解释性风险评分与自动化策略库,支持规则热更新与本地沙箱回放。
七、市场未来趋势(结语前瞻)
- 更细粒度的链上许可协议、基于时间与用途的Scoped Approvals将成为常态;硬件/软件融合的钱包、多方计算与AI驱动的实时风控将主导用户体验。
结语:授权不是一步操作而是“持续治理”的工程。将权限看作可配置、可监控、可回溯的生命周期,才能把TP钱包的不安全变成可控风险。谨慎授权,分层防护,让每一次签名都可审计、可撤回、可解释。
评论
Tom
很实用的流程化建议,尤其是mempool感知那段,能否推荐具体库?
小艾
关于默认最小额度和时间窗的UI设计思路很到位,期望看到示例界面。
CryptoFan
MPC+AA的组合确实是未来,作者对撤销机制的强调很有洞见。
张明
文章条理清晰,适合开发者和普通用户阅读,感谢分享。